Community Bridges, Inc. (CBI) is an integrated behavioral healthcare agency offering a variety of programs throughout Arizona. CBI provides residential, outpatient, inpatient, patient-centered medical homes, medication-assisted treatment, and crisis services to individuals experiencing crisis, opioid use disorder, homelessness, and mental illness.

Responsibilities- Oversee the outreach, shelter, housing and community-based programs in the defined area.
- Directly supervise the management-level staff over these programs.
- Ensure programs maintain compliance with contract requirements, meet productivity requirements, and achieve program-defined outcomes.
- Develop assigned managers and staff, including creating training plans to address gaps in care.
- Collaborate with managers on reviewing innovative approaches to service delivery and guide implementation.
- Partner with the CBI finance department on grant management and budget tracking.
- Monitor program compliance and represent Community Bridges within the community, seeking partnerships and funding opportunities to expand the continuum of care.
- Serve as liaison for the CBI Patient Centered Medical Homes, Crisis, and Inpatient units to connect to Housing and Community Integration resources and knowledge.
- High school diploma or GED required. An Associate Degree or higher in a field related to behavioral health is preferred.
- Recovery from Alcohol or Drugs and/or GMH for equal to or greater than 1 consecutive year preferred.
- 1 year of experience in a behavioral health position providing outreach and engagement activities.
- 1–3 years of grant writing experience, program development and/or grant monitoring.
- Current AZ Driver's License (valid and in good standing).
- Clear 39-month Motor Vehicle Record.
- Behavioral Health Technician (BHT) in accordance with A.A.C. R and CBI clinical policies and procedures.
- Arizona Fingerprint Clearance Card (if applicable).
- Jail Clearance (if applicable).
